Forklifts generally fall into two categories: industrial and rough terrain. Urkijo says that after very good results in Europe over the past couple of years for rough-terrain forklifts, he fears that Europe will experience a decrease in economic growth in the next few years.
Where typical fork lift trucks need to approach a load head on, on a flat even surface, an all-terrain or rough terrain forklift can pick up a load even when the load is on a slope or otherwise unusually positioned. Rough terrain forklifts are designed to provide you with a rugged, powerful machine that can move large loads without needing a perfectly flat operating surface. While standard forklifts require aisles that are at least eleven feet wide to operate, a narrow aisle (NA) forklift can work in spaces that are 8 to 10 feet wide, while very narrow aisle forklifts (VNA) can operate in aisles as narrow as 6 feet.
